- Title
[CrF(O<sub>2</sub>C<sup> t</sup>Bu)<sub>2</sub>]<sub>9</sub>: Synthesis and Characterization of a Regular Homometallic Ring with an Odd Number of Metal Centers and Electrons.
- Authors
Woolfson, Robert J.; Timco, Grigore A.; Chiesa, Alessandro; Vitorica-Yrezabal, Inigo J.; Tuna, Floriana; Guidi, Tatiana; Pavarini, Eva; Santini, Paolo; Carretta, Stefano; Winpenny, Richard E. P.
- Abstract
The first regular homometallic ring containing an odd number of metal centers is reported. The ring was synthesized by means of amine-templated self-assembly. Extensive physical characterization studies, including magnetic measurements, powder inelastic neutron scattering (INS), and DFT calculations, show that the molecule has a near perfect match to the expected behavior for a frustrated system with the lowest energy pair of S=1/2 spin states separated by only 0.1 meV (0.8 cm−1).
